Reported estimates and uncertainty · 6 rows
Each comparison sign applies to its own reading or uncertainty endpoint. Values retain source precision. “Not reported” identifies an absent reading or uncertainty endpoint in this source capture.
| Country | Year | Reading | Lower endpoint | Upper endpoint | Publisher note |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Malaysia | 1999 | 20.7 | Not reported | Not reported | A study of malnutrition in under five children in Malaysia.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ia: Ministry of Health, 2000 Converted estimate |
| Malaysia | 2006 | 17.5 | 16.5 | 18.6 | Malaysia National Health And Morbidity Survey 2006.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ia: Institute for Public Health, Ministry of Health (Malaysia) Age calculated using alternate methods; Height/length modality (standing/lying) was not collected |
| Malaysia | 2015 | 17.8 | 15.8 | 20 | National Health and Morbidity Survey 2015 (NHMS 2015),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ia: IPH, 2015. Height/length modality (standing/lying) was not collected |
| Malaysia | 2016 | 20.8 | 18.9 | 22.9 | Malaysia National Health and Morbidity Survey 2016 Height/length modality (standing/lying) was not collected |
| Malaysia | 2019 | 25.5 | 21.9 | 29.4 | Malaysia National Health and Morbidity Survey (NHMS) 2019 Height/length modality (standing/lying) was not collected |
| Malaysia | 2022 | 21.2 | 20 | 22.6 | Malaysia National Health and Morbidity Survey 2022 |
